(KCEN) -- A developer is taking a new approach to meet the growing housing needs of one Texas city.
David Monnich of San Antonio is building 70 new apartments, using mostly recycled shipping containers.
He chose the south Texas city of Encinal for the project because of the extremely high demand for housing there.
Monnich says he'll also have a good chance to turn a profit since the container-based housing units are not expensive to produce.
